    Abstract Background: To date, many researches have investigated the correlation of folate and asthma occurrence. Nevertheless, few studies have discussed whether folate status is correlated with dis-ease severity, control or progression of asthma. So, we explored the correlation of serum folate and blood eosinophil counts in asthmatic adults to gain the role of folate in the control, progression, and treatment of asthma.
    Methods: Data were obtained from the 2011-2018 NHANES, in which serum folate, blood eosinophils, and other covariates were measured among 2332 asthmatic adults. The regression model, XGBoost algorithm model, and generalized linear model were used to explore the potential correlation. Moreover, we conducted stratified analyses to determine certain populations.
    Results: Among three models, the multivariate regression analysis demonstrated serum folate levels were negatively correlated with blood eosinophil counts among asthmatic adults with statistical significance. And we observed that blood eosinophil counts decreased by 0.20 (-0.34, -0.06)/uL for each additional unit of serum folate (nmol/L) after adjusting for confounders. Moreover, we used the XGBoost Algorithm model to identify the relative significance of chosen variables correlated with blood eosinophil counts and observed the linear relationship between serum folate levels and blood eosinophil counts by constructing the generalized linear model.
    Conclusions: Our study indicated that serum folate levels were inversely associated with blood eosinophil counts in asthmatic adult populations of America, which indicated serum folate might be correlated with the immune status of asthmatic adults in some way. We suggested that serum folate might affect the control, development, and treatment of asthma. Finally, we hope more people will recognize the role of folate in asthma.

    Abstract Background: Assessment of lung function is essential for the early screening chronic airway diseases (CADs). Nevertheless, it is still not widely used for early diagnosing CADs in epidemiological or primary care settings. Thus, we used data from the US National Health and Nutrition Examination Survey (NHANES) to discuss the relationship between the serum uric acid/serum creatinine (SUA/SCr) ratio and lung function in general adults to gain the role of SUA/SCr in early assessment of lung function abnormalities.
    Methods: From 2007 to 2012 NHANES, a total of 9569 people were included in our study. Using the regression model, XGBoost algorithm model, generalised linear model and two-piecewise linear regression model, the link between the SUA/SCr ratio and lung function was investigated.
    Results: After correcting for confounding variables, the data revealed that forced vital capacity (FVC) declined by 47.630 and forced expiratory volume in one second (FEV1) decreased by 36.956 for each additional unit of SUA/SCr ratio. However, there was no association between SUA/SCr and FEV1/FVC. In the XGBoost model of FVC, the top five most important were glycohaemoglobin, total bilirubin, SUA/SCr, total cholesterol and aspartate aminotransferase, whereas in FEV1, were glycohaemoglobin, total bilirubin, total cholesterol, SUA/SCr and serum calcium. In addition, we determined the linear and inverse association between SUA/SCr ratio and FVC or FEV1 by constructing a smooth curve.
    Conclusions: In the general American population, the SUA/SCr ratio is inversely linked with FVC and FEV1, but not with FEV1/FVC, according to our research. Future studies should investigate the impact of SUA/SCr on lung function and identify possible mechanisms of action.

    Abstract Background: A growing number of research strongly suggest that metabolic syndrome and dyslipidemia contribute to the establishment of a pro-inflammatory state in asthma, according to accumulating data. However, the majority of recent research has focused on the association between lipids and asthma in children and adolescents, with contradictory findings. Consequently, we analyzed the relationship between serum lipid and blood eosinophil counts using data from the NHANES in the USA.
    Methods: After screening the individuals from the 2011 to 2018 NHANES survey, a total of 2,544 out of 39156 participants were eligible for our study. The potential association was discussed using the linear regression model, XGBoost algorithm model, generalized additive model, and two-piecewise linear regression model. In addition, we ran stratified analysis to identify specific demographics.
    Results: After adjusting for covariates, the result indicated that blood eosinophil counts decreased by 45.68 (-68.56, -22.79)/uL for each additional unit of HDL-C (mmol/L). But serum LDL-C, total cholesterol or triglyceride was not correlated with blood eosinophil counts. Furthermore, we used machine learning of the XGBoost model to determine LDL-C, age, BMI, triglyceride, and HDL-C were the five most critical variables in the blood eosinophil counts. The generalized additive model and two-piecewise linear regression model were used to further identify linear relationship between the serum HDL-C and blood eosinophil counts.
    Conclusions: Our study elucidated a negative and linear correlation between serum HDL-C and blood eosinophil counts among American asthmatic adults, suggesting that serum HDL-C levels might be associated with the immunological condition of asthmatic adults. There was no correlation between serum LDL-C, total cholesterol, or triglyceride levels and blood eosinophil counts.

    Abstract Background: So far, quite a few studies have revealed that systemic iron levels are related to asthmatic inflammatory reactions. And most studies have focused on the correlation between systemic iron levels and asthma, with inconsistent findings. Yet, few studies have investigated the connection between serum iron and blood eosinophil counts. Hence, we have explored the connection between serum iron and blood eosinophil counts in asthmatics by utilizing data from NHANES.
    Methods: A total of 2549 individuals were included in our study after screening NHANES participants from 2011 to 2018. The linear regression model and XGBoost model were used to discuss the potential connection. Linear or nonlinear association was further confirmed by the generalized additive model and the piecewise linear regression model. And we also performed stratified analyses to figure out specific populations.
    Results: In the multivariable linear regression models, we discovered that serum iron levels were inversely related to blood eosinophil counts in asthmatic adults. Simultaneously, we found that for every unit increase in serum iron (umol/L), blood eosinophil counts reduced by 1.41/uL in model 3, which adjusted for all variables excluding the analyzed variables. Furthermore, the XGBoost model of machine learning was applied to assess the relative importance of chosen variables, and it was determined that vitamin C intake, age, vitamin B12 intake, iron intake, and serum iron were the five most important variables on blood eosinophil counts. And the generalized additive model and piecewise linear regression model further verify this linear and inverse association.
    Conclusion: Our investigation discovered that the linear and inverse association of serum iron with blood eosinophil counts in asthmatic adults, indicating that serum iron might be related to changes in the immunological state of asthmatics. Our work offers some new thoughts for next research on asthma management and therapy. Ultimately, we hope that more individuals become aware of the role of iron in the onset, development, and treatment of asthma.

    Abstract Background and aims: Multiple meta-analyses have evaluated the technical and clinical success of EUS-guided biliary drainage (BD), but meta-analyses concerning adverse events (AEs) are limited. The present meta-analysis analyzed AEs associated with various types of EUS-BD.
    Methods: A literature search of MEDLINE, Embase, and Scopus was conducted from 2005 to September 2022 for studies analyzing the outcome of EUS-BD. The primary outcomes were incidence of overall AEs, major AEs, procedure-related mortality, and reintervention. The event rates were pooled using a random-effects model.
    Results: One hundred fifty-five studies (7887 patients) were included in the final analysis. The pooled clinical success rates and incidence of AEs with EUS-BD were 95% (95% confidence interval [CI], 94.1-95.9) and 13.7% (95% CI, 12.3-15.0), respectively. Among early AEs, bile leak was the most common followed by cholangitis with pooled incidences of 2.2% (95% CI, 1.8-2.7) and 1.0% (95% CI, .8-1.3), respectively. The pooled incidences of major AEs and procedure-related mortality with EUS-BD were .6% (95% CI, .3-.9) and .1% (95% CI, .0-.4), respectively. The pooled incidences of delayed migration and stent occlusion were 1.7% (95% CI, 1.1-2.3) and 11.0% (95% CI, 9.3-12.8), respectively. The pooled event rate for reintervention (for stent migration or occlusion) after EUS-BD was 16.2% (95% CI, 14.0-18.3; I
    Conclusions: Despite a high clinical success rate, EUS-BD may be associated with AEs in one-seventh of the cases. However, major AEs and mortality incidence remain less than 1%, which is reassuring.

    Abstract Lung cancer is often diagnosed at an advanced stage and is associated with significant morbidity and mortality. Low-dose computed tomography for lung cancer screening has increased the incidence of peripheral pulmonary lesions. Surveillance and early detection of these lesions at risk of developing cancer are critical for improving patient survival. Because these lesions are usually distal to the lobar and segmental bronchi, they are not directly visible with standard flexible bronchoscopes resulting in low diagnostic yield for small lesions <2 cm. The past 30 years have seen several paradigm shifts in diagnostic bronchoscopy. Recent technological advances in navigation bronchoscopy combined with other modalities have enabled sampling lesions beyond central airways. However, smaller peripheral lesions remain challenging for bronchoscopic biopsy. This review provides an overview of recent advances in interventional bronchoscopy in the screening, diagnosis, and treatment of peripheral pulmonary lesions, with a particular focus on virtual bronchoscopic navigation.

    Abstract Background: Medical students play an indispensable role in providing smoking cessation counseling. Despite the rapid increase in tobacco use, there is little data on what Chinese medical students know or are taught about it. This study aims to investigate the relationship between medical students' tobacco education level, clinical experience, and tobacco cessation counseling (TCC) provided by medical students.
    Methods: This cross-sectional study was carried out among clinical medical students of Chongqing medical university. An anonymous, self-administered questionnaire included items on demographic information, perceptions, and perceived preparedness, clinical medical students' self-reported level of education about alternative tobacco products, and traditional cigarettes. We assessed their perspectives toward TCC using a 5-point Likert scale. Descriptive and binary logistic regression analyses were carried out.
    Results: A total of 1,263 medical students completed the questionnaire. The majority of students (85%) expressed a willingness to provide TCC to patients in need. However, only half of the students stated unequivocally that they knew some ways and methods of tobacco cessation, while 18% stated that they did not know methods of tobacco cessation. Tobacco education and clinical experience were significantly associated with the ability to provide TCC. Our findings revealed that students with more clinical experience (undergraduates: B = 0.326,
    Conclusion: Tobacco education and clinical experience can enhance the ability of medical students to provide smoking cessation counseling. There is a need to focus on alternative tobacco products with changing times, and curriculum planners should collaborate to incorporate comprehensive tobacco prevention and cessation training into the medical school curriculum.
